Reggie Rockstone

Celebrated Ghanaian music legend and entrepreneur Reggie Rockstone has extended heartfelt gratitude to the Ghana National Fire Service for their timely intervention during a fire outbreak at the Accra Tourist Information Centre (ATIC), where his popular eatery, Rockz Waakye, is located.

The fire, which broke out recently, caused damage to sections of the ATIC complex and affected a number of businesses operating within the facility, including Reggie Rockstone’s food venture. Although the incident sparked public outcry and criticism toward emergency response services, Rockstone took a different approach—choosing appreciation over blame.

Rockstone Responds with Gratitude, Not Blame

In the aftermath of the fire, Reggie Rockstone personally visited the scene and met with fire service personnel who were involved in containing the blaze. Moved by their commitment and the risks they took, he decided to honor them with food packs from his own kitchen.

As a symbolic gesture of thanks, he provided meals from Rockz Waakye to the firefighters, stating that although his shop was affected, he felt it necessary to show appreciation rather than resentment. His act has drawn widespread admiration across social media and in public discourse, reinforcing his reputation not only as a pioneer of Ghanaian hiplife music but also as a man of integrity and community spirit.

“They Did Their Best” – Reggie Urges Public Support

Speaking to the media at the scene, Rockstone encouraged Ghanaians to refrain from blaming the firefighters, explaining that such personnel often work under difficult and under-resourced conditions. He emphasized that despite the challenges, the fire service did its best to minimize the damage and prevent the situation from escalating further.

“Let’s not bash them. These men and women risk their lives for us. They did their best, and for that, I’m thankful,” Rockstone said.

He further called on the public to support emergency responders rather than criticize them. According to him, the energy spent blaming them could be redirected toward calls for better equipment, more training, and government support for fire service institutions.

Rockz Waakye

The fire at the Accra Tourist Information Centre, a hub for tourism and creative arts activities in Accra. Rockz Waakye, a beloved food spot known for its tasty waakye dishes and cultural ambiance.

While the extent of the damage to his waakye joint is still being assessed, Rockstone remains hopeful and determined to bounce back. In a follow-up message to his fans and customers, he assured them that Rockz Waakye will return, stronger and better than before.

“We’ll rebuild. This is not the end. The Rockz Waakye experience will continue—count on it,” he wrote on social media.

Fire Incident Sparks Call for Better Safety Measures

The fire has reignited conversations about fire safety protocols and infrastructure in public buildings across Accra. Many business owners at the ATIC complex have expressed concerns about the lack of adequate fire prevention systems, including alarms, extinguishers, and sprinkler systems.

In light of these events, Rockstone joined the chorus of voices advocating for improved safety measures in commercial and tourism centers. He stressed the importance of proactive planning, regular safety audits, and more investment into fire service departments to prevent future disasters.

Community Rallies Behind Reggie Rockstone

Following the incident, a wave of support has poured in for Reggie Rockstone. Fans, friends, and fellow industry professionals have lauded his positive attitude and humility, praising him for his leadership in turning a painful situation into a moment of compassion and community unity.

Hashtags such as #RockzWaakyeStrong, #ReggieCares, and #SupportFirefighters have begun trending online, sparking a social movement encouraging more appreciation for Ghana’s essential service workers.
